Ruth Mackenzie was appointed Director of the Cultural Olympiad in January of this year.
She was formerly an expert adviser on broadcasting and cultural policy for the Department for Culture, Media and Sport. Her previous roles include first General Director of the Manchester International Festival, Artistic Director of Chichester Festival Theatre and General Director, Scottish Opera. She has also worked on a consultancy basis for the Barbican Centre, Tate, BBC, London Symphony Orchestra and Young Vic. She was awarded an OBE for her services to the theatre in 1995.
